About David

David Luker has 21 years of experience in public accounting including GAAP financial statement audits of construction contractors, construction contract compliance/cost recovery for large construction manager-at-risk and design-build contracts, construction change order and claim analysis, construction litigation support, design and construction process reengineering, and various other risk consulting services.

He serves as RSM’s facilities and construction subject matter expert for the Southeast region and is 100% dedicated to serving the construction industry. David annually conducts between 15 and 20 construction audit/cost recovery engagements on major cost-plus construction projects ranging from $10 million to $1 billion in contract value. In his current role, he serves as the construction audit director/lead on a four-year $1.2 billion mixed-use construction project in Miami, a three-year engagement auditing $160 million of construction manager at risk contracts for a Florida university system, and a five-year $900 million construction program audit and assessment engagement.


Experience

Prior to joining RSM, David worked for a Big Four accounting firm in audit, and a regional accounting firm in audit, tax and consulting. He has led internal audit and contract compliance/administration teams on a three-year, phased governmental audit initiative, including extensive audit and compliance work pursuant to a watershed consent decree. David has also led a three-year internal audit and contract compliance/evaluation engagement on a $1.2 billion Mid-Atlantic region construction program. He has experience leading construction-focused forensic investigations and has provided construction litigation and mediation support to clients including tribal governments, school districts, construction contractors and private equity.
